I remember when I was little, our abuelita used to warn us about the sun. Even with the suntan lotion we used, we would get sunburn or our skin would dry out. Our abuelita always had the aloe vera ready to rub on our sunburn. She also used to use petroleum jelly or coconut oil to keep our skin smooth. I hated them both because the coconut oil and petroleum jelly were always greasy and sticky. I always felt uncomfortable after the application and it used to get on our clothes and hair. I loved my abuelita but I would always go and wipe it off.
